1. Daily Output Tracking

Implement effective daily output tracking methods using a whiteboard, spreadsheet, or notebook.

Track:

  • Videos posted
  • Lives hosted
  • Hooks tested
  • CTA placement
  • View count (basic)

3. Go Live Even When You’re Not Ready

Especially for TikTok Shop. The top earners go live daily using effective TikTok Shop live selling strategies. It builds real skill and creates sales faster than any video, thanks to the benefits of live streaming for sales.

Start with 10 minutes. Set a timer. Don’t sell—just talk. This approach allows for on-the-spot product promotion techniques that engage your audience directly. You’ll get better by doing, not just by watching others.

Focus on your inputs, this not only includes the amount of hours you are going live daily which is important (TikTok recommends 90 minutes daily) but also on other input factors such as quality. If you are doing a TikTok Shop livestream, do you know your product? If viewers asks you questions are you ready to answer them knowledgeably?
